Transaction

fbf2ce99a83743134e10b3fa5f22a8800dc2618f8376fdd565c4a092987c8b06
639,468 confirmations
Timestamp
1398976318
Block298,657
Fee20,000 sats
Fee rate45.7 sats/vB
view on mempool.space

Inputs & Outputs